Know your product categories: Core indoor water park equipment

Understanding the equipment categories helps you prioritize spend, schedule installation, and plan operations. Below are the major categories to consider when buying indoor water park equipment.

Water slides and flumes

Slides are the headline attractions that drive ticket sales. Indoor water park equipment options range from family slides and enclosed tube slides to multi-lane racing slides and complex raft/ride systems. Material choice, manufacturing precision, and modular design impact safety, durability, and installation timelines.

Wave pools, leisure pools and activity pools

Wave systems, zero-entry leisure pools, and play pools are core features for family appeal. Indoor installations require integrated HVAC considerations and dehumidification systems to protect equipment and ensure guest comfort.

Children’s play structures and splash pads

Interactive play systems, tipping buckets, spray features, and shallow pools drive repeat visits from families with young children. Durability and easy-to-service components are critical for high-turnover areas.

Water treatment, pumps and filtration systems

Behind-the-scenes systems ensure hygiene and operational efficiency. Pumps, filtration, chemical dosing, and automation systems are central to compliance and operational cost control. Specifying energy-efficient pumps and controls reduces lifecycle costs.

Auxiliary systems and theming

Deck surfacing, safety barriers, lifeguard stations, lighting, sound, and theming elements complete the guest experience. For indoor parks, corrosion-resistant materials and sealed electrical systems are required for longevity.

How to specify indoor water park equipment: technical and commercial priorities

Specification must balance guest experience, safety, durability, and cost. Use these priorities as a checklist during procurement.

Capacity and throughput planning

Define target hourly throughput for marquee attractions and the overall park to avoid bottlenecks. Specify slide throughput rates, queue footprints, and dispatch systems to match your expected attendance patterns and revenue model.

Material and build quality

Fiberglass-reinforced plastic (FRP) is the industry standard for water slides due to its strength, finish quality, and ease of customization. Confirm resin and gelcoat specifications, reinforcement schedules, and UV/corrosion protections for indoor environments with heavy humidity.

Safety and rider experience

Specify design parameters for safe g-forces, rider restraint where applicable, water depth at landings, and non-slip surfaces. Include requirements for certified testing, third-party ride dynamics review, and clear manufacturer guidance on operational limits.

Maintenance and serviceability

Request design features that facilitate inspection and repair: removable panels, accessible anchors, and spare parts lists. Ask about recommended maintenance intervals and estimated downtime for common service tasks.

Energy efficiency and lifecycle cost

Evaluate pumps, heaters, heat-recovery options, and circulation system efficiencies. Initial purchase price tells only part of the story; total cost of ownership (TCO) includes energy, chemicals, parts, labor, and refurbishment over the life of the asset.

Choosing the right supplier: what to evaluate in bids

Selecting a supplier requires both technical and commercial evaluation. Use a structured RFP and scorecard to compare vendors objectively.

Proven track record and references

Prioritize suppliers with demonstrable experience in indoor water park equipment and relevant installations. Design and engineering capabilities

Prefer vendors that provide integrated design services, ride engineering, structural interfaces, and MEP coordination. A supplier who understands HVAC, pool shell interfaces, and building constraints reduces risk and accelerates delivery.

Manufacturing capacity and quality control

Verify factory capabilities, production lead times, quality assurance processes, and inspection regimes. A large, modern production base shortens lead times and helps ensure consistent quality for complex systems.

Delivery, installation and after-sales support

Confirm that the supplier handles installation supervision, commissioning, operator training, and spare parts supply. Long-term maintenance agreements and rapid response for warranty issues are essential for minimal downtime.

Certifications and compliance

Ensure suppliers demonstrate compliance with applicable local and international regulations, and that they provide documentation for materials, structural calculations, and water treatment equipment. Ask about third-party testing for ride safety and water quality systems.

Financial planning: budgeting, procurement models, and ROI

Budgeting for an indoor water park requires a clear view of capital expenditure, contingency, and operating cost forecasts.

CapEx vs. OpEx considerations

Decide whether to buy, lease, or enter a revenue-sharing agreement for major attractions. While outright purchase maximizes control, financing or vendor-managed models can reduce initial capital burden but may increase long-term costs.

Estimating lifecycle costs

Include energy, water treatment chemicals, spare parts, annual maintenance labor, and periodic refurbishment. Many operators schedule major refurbishments or re-gelcoating cycles every 10–15 years depending on usage and environment.

Measuring ROI and KPIs

Use metrics such as revenue per visit, average ticket price uplift from new attractions, operating margin, and utilization rates. Consider guest satisfaction and repeat visitation as leading indicators of long-term ROI.

Procurement best practices and contract terms

Strong contracts protect both buyer and supplier and minimize disputes. Include clear deliverables, milestones, and acceptance criteria in procurement documents.

Milestones and acceptance testing

Define factory acceptance tests, FAT for mechanical and electrical systems, site acceptance testing, and final performance acceptance for rides and water systems. Include liquidated damages for missed critical milestones when appropriate.

Warranty scope and spare parts

Specify warranty durations, exclusions, and the availability of critical spares. Ask suppliers for a recommended spare parts list for the first 3–5 years and lead times for non-stocked items.

Training and documentation

Require operator and maintenance team training, plus comprehensive O&M manuals, troubleshooting guides, and parts diagrams. These deliverables reduce downtime and extend asset life.

Installation, commissioning and operational handover

Successful installation is a collaboration among your project team, contractor, and equipment supplier. Plan for quality control, safety, and scheduled testing.

Site coordination and MEP integration

Coordinate water systems with HVAC, dehumidification, electrical distribution, and structural anchors. Early involvement of the equipment supplier in site planning prevents costly rework.

Commissioning and operator training

Commission water treatment systems to verify chemical controls and filtration performance. Conduct lifeguard and operations training on ride dispatch, emergency procedures, and routine maintenance tasks.

Maintenance, refurbishment and long-term asset management

Plan maintenance programs to preserve safety and guest experience while controlling costs.

Preventive maintenance schedules

Adopt preventive maintenance intervals that cover daily inspections, weekly checks, monthly system tests, and annual deep inspections. Track metrics like downtime events, headcount for maintenance, and parts consumption to refine schedules.

Refurbishment planning

Budget for surface refurbishments, re-gelcoating, hardware replacement, and mechanical overhauls. Well-documented service history from the manufacturer or operator helps forecast major capital refreshes.

Safety, compliance and guest experience

Safety is non-negotiable. Combine good design, operational protocols, and staff training to reduce risk and enhance guest confidence.

Operational policies and staffing

Define lifeguard-to-guest ratios, incident reporting, ride dispatch rules, and emergency response plans. Regular drills and certification renewals help maintain readiness.

Guest communication and accessibility

Provide clear signage for height, weight, and health restrictions; communicate queue times and safety expectations; and ensure accessibility options where feasible.

Frequently Asked Questions

Q: What is the typical lifespan of indoor water park equipment such as fiberglass slides?
A: The industry often cites a service life of roughly 15–25 years for well-maintained fiberglass water slides, depending on usage, environmental conditions, surface wear, and maintenance regimes. Regular inspections and refurbishments extend usable life.

Q: How should I evaluate energy costs when buying water park equipment?
A: Request energy performance data for pumps, heaters, and circulation systems. Look for high-efficiency pumps, variable-speed drives, heat-recovery options, and integrated control systems to minimize operating costs over time.

Q: Do indoor parks need different materials than outdoor parks?
A: Indoor environments have high humidity and different UV exposure; choose corrosion-resistant metals, proper gelcoats, and sealed electrical components. Materials should be specified for long-term indoor humidity exposure and chemical environments.

Q: What warranty and service terms should I require?
A: Require clear warranty durations for structural and mechanical components, defined exclusions, and response times for service. Insist on a spare parts list and recommended stocking levels for critical items.

Q: How soon should a supplier be involved in the project lifecycle?
A: Engage equipment suppliers early during conceptual design and MEP coordination stages. Early involvement reduces design conflicts, shortens timelines, and ensures smoother installation and commissioning.
